Not sure if it was in all the Sat papers but Downies are selling an 'out with the pence and in with the cents' carded set. This includes all the 63/64 pre-decimal coins and the 66 decimals (obviously not all mints, just one of each). All are in UNC (according to the blurb). Maccas catalogue value for this lot is $128. They are selling them for $95 delivered. Seems like an OK deal, especially if you are trying to build up UNC series in bits and pieces from ebay. I'll be buying a set and breaking the coins out of the card! Shatsi, If you are only interested in the 1c & 2c coins, then try the following web site: http://oldcoin.com.au/They offer the following coins for AUD$25.00 total - I took the information from their Australian Decimal Coins section: 26 Different 1c/2c coins.
Australian 1c coins, 1966, 1973, 1975, 1976, 1977, 1978, 1979, 1980, 1981, 1982, 1983, 1984, 1987 and 2c coins 1966, 1970, 1975, 1976, 1977, 1978, 1979, 1980, 1981, 1982, 1983, 1984, 1989.
All taken from mint rolls, all with mint red, as issued. Usual light bag marks/contacts caused in the minting process, otherwise Uncirculated. Some quite hard to get in original condition, with mint bloom. Catalogue value $70+ (26 coins in total).I have bought from this company many times before, and they have always been great purchases with no hassles at all. Good luck!
